Lot 1
The NHS Wales Shared Services Partnership, hosted by Velindre NHS Trust are acting on behalf of all Health Boards in Wales who are seeking to appoint supplier/s to provide Stoma Services across Wales. Health Boards across NHS Wales provide a Colorectal and Stoma Service to support patients who require a stoma (artificial opening in the abdomen allowing waste to exit the body). This is surgically performed most commonly for patients with Cancer, Colitis, Crohns Disease or inflammatory bowel disease. The current service consists of a multidisciplinary team with the overall aim of providing an integrated care pathway for patients spanning Primary Care and Secondary Care. Following surgery and an assessment by Clinical Nurse Specialist: Stoma / Colorectal, the patient is discharged into primary care with an initial supply of products and advice on obtaining further supplies. The CNS provides ongoing patient care via clinics. This competitive dialogue process is exploring a Value Based Health Care approach to this condition area, which will provide the opportunity to not only consider costs but also the outcomes associated across the whole cycle of care, which will ultimately result in the best outcomes for all patients requiring stoma care provision across NHS Wales. The recommended bidder may be required (dependant on awarded option) to support the provision of the Stoma Care Service as follows: - Income to resource clinical team and activities - appropriate training and education - IT equipment and software to manage patient information on a potential All Wales basis - Consumables including free sample products for use within hospitals and free products for patient discharges - Cutting for prescriptions Please note that this list is not inclusive and could be subject to change whilst progressing through the competitive dialogue stages. In addition, it should also be noted that whilst NHS Wales is looking for a whole system approach, it reserves the right to split the requirement (for instance, regionally but not limited to this example) depending on the needs of the service and the dialogue that occurs within this Procurement.
